Abstract :
This paper presents an enhanced AMVP mechanism and an adaptive motion search range algorithm to reduce the coding complexity of the high efficiency video coding (HEVC) standard. The performance of motion estimation highly depended on the selection of advanced motion vector prediction (AMVP) mechanism. With this point of view, we firstly design a new selection algorithm to increase the accuracy of AMVP. After getting an accurate motion vector predictor (MVP), we analyze the relationship of motion vector difference (MD) between MVP and motion vector (MV) to design an adaptive motion search range algorithm. Experimental results show that the proposed algorithms can not only decrease the coding complexity but also keep the coding performance.
